So can you run a garbage disposal on a septic system in Maine? Technically, yes. Nothing about a disposal will destroy a tank overnight. But it adds real solid load to a system that was designed around a certain amount of waste, and that extra load has to go somewhere — either it settles in your tank and gets pumped out more often, or it works its way toward your drain field, where it does more lasting damage. If you’re asking whether it’s a good idea, our honest answer is: we’d skip it.
What a Disposal Actually Sends Into Your Tank
A garbage disposal doesn’t make food waste disappear. It grinds it into smaller particles and sends it down the pipe with a burst of water. That’s a meaningful difference from what your septic tank was built to handle.
Toilet paper and human waste break down relatively fast once they hit the anaerobic environment inside your tank. Ground-up food scraps don’t break down nearly as quickly, especially fibrous stuff like celery, onion skins, and eggshells, or fatty material like meat trimmings. Instead of dissolving, a lot of it just settles into the sludge layer at the bottom of the tank and sits there.
Multiple studies on residential septic loading, along with what we see firsthand pumping tanks across Penobscot County, point to the same range: households running a disposal regularly add roughly 30 to 50 percent more solids to their tank compared to households that scrape plates into the trash or a compost bin. That’s not a rounding error. It’s the difference between a tank that needs attention every four years and one that needs it every two and a half.
Why That Extra Solid Load Matters More in Maine
A few things about septic systems here make this a bigger deal than it might be in a warmer, less rural state.
Short pumping season, longer intervals between checks. Between mud season limiting truck access and winter freeze-up shutting the door entirely, a lot of Maine homeowners end up pumping on a tighter practical window than the calendar suggests. If your tank is filling faster than expected because of a disposal, you’re more likely to get caught off guard between visits.
Rural drive times mean bigger bills when things go wrong. A tank that backs up because it wasn’t pumped in time, out on a back road in Glenburn or Eddington, doesn’t get a same-day fix as easily as one two minutes from the shop. Extra solids from a disposal raise the odds you’re calling for an emergency visit instead of a scheduled one.
Clay and ledge soils don’t forgive an overloaded field. A lot of drain fields around here already work with thin or heavy soils. If solids bypass the tank and reach the field — which happens more easily when a tank is fuller than it should be — that material clogs the soil pores that let effluent absorb properly. Once a field starts clogging with solids, there’s no additive or trick that reverses it. The Real Cost Math
Here’s a simple way to look at what a disposal actually costs you over time, not counting whatever the appliance itself cost to install.
| Factor | No disposal (typical) | Regular disposal use |
|---|---|---|
| Sludge/scum buildup rate | Baseline | 30-50% faster |
| Typical pumping interval, 1,000-gal tank, 3-person household | 3-5 years | 2-3.5 years |
| Extra pump-outs over 15 years | — | 1 to 2 additional visits |
| Risk of premature drain field clogging | Lower | Higher |
Run that out over the life of a system and an extra pump-out or two, at a few hundred dollars each, adds up. It’s real money, and it’s optional money — spent because of a kitchen habit, not because the tank needed it on its own schedule. If You’re Keeping the Disposal Anyway
We get it — some households aren’t giving up the disposal, whether it came with the house or it’s just how they cook. If that’s you, here’s how to keep the damage manageable.
Run it sparingly, not constantly. Save it for the occasional scrap instead of routing every dinner’s worth of waste through it. The difference between “used a few times a week” and “used every night” is significant over a few years.
Skip the fibrous and fatty stuff. Onion skins, celery strings, coffee grounds, and grease are the worst offenders for building sludge that won’t break down. Scrape those into the trash even if the disposal is right there.
Run cold water, not hot, while it’s grinding. Cold water keeps any grease solid enough to move through and out rather than coating the inside of your pipes and tank.
Shorten your pumping interval on purpose. Don’t wait for signs your tank needs pumping to show up — those symptoms usually mean you’re already later than ideal. If you’d normally be on a four-year rotation, plan for closer to three. Ask whoever pumps your tank to measure the sludge and scum layers each visit rather than guessing, and use that reading to fine-tune your actual interval instead of one lifted from a rule of thumb.

The Alternatives We’d Actually Recommend
If you haven’t installed a disposal yet, or you’re weighing whether to replace a broken one, consider skipping it entirely.
A trash can for scraps. The simplest option. Zero solid load added to your tank, zero cost, zero extra pump-outs. The tradeoff is a slightly smellier kitchen trash bin if you don’t take it out often enough.
A countertop or backyard compost setup. Popular with a lot of the camp owners and gardeners we work with around Hampden and Veazie. Food scraps become useful compost instead of septic load, and it keeps grease and coffee grounds — two things that genuinely hurt a system — out of your pipes for good.
A septic-rated disposal used lightly, if you really want one. Some units are marketed as septic-safe because they grind finer or add a bacteria dose with each use. They reduce particle size, which helps somewhat, but they don’t eliminate the added solid load. Treat “septic-safe” as “less bad,” not “no impact.”
Whatever you land on, the goal is the same: less material entering the tank means a longer stretch between pump-outs and a healthier drain field for the life of the system. That’s true whether you’re on a full-time home in Bangor or a seasonal place you’re only opening up for the summer.
Bottom Line
A garbage disposal on a septic system isn’t a code violation and it won’t cause a backup the first week you use it. But it’s a slow tax on your tank — 30 to 50 percent more solids, a shorter pumping interval, and a real risk of pushing material toward a drain field that’s expensive to replace and impossible to fully fix once it’s clogged. If we’re being straight with you: we’d skip it, or use it sparingly and plan your pumping schedule around it rather than around a generic rule of thumb.

Frequently Asked Questions
Can you use a garbage disposal with a septic system in Maine?
Yes, a septic system can technically handle a garbage disposal, but it is not a good match. Ground food scraps add extra solids to the tank, which fills it faster and pushes more material toward the drain field over time.
How much does a garbage disposal increase septic solids?
Research and field experience both point to roughly 30 to 50 percent more solid accumulation in a tank that regularly receives ground food waste compared to one that does not, which shortens the time between pump-outs.
Do I need to pump my septic tank more often if I have a garbage disposal?
Generally yes. A household with a disposal in regular use often needs to shorten its pumping interval by a year or more compared to the same household without one, depending on tank size and usage.
What should I use instead of a garbage disposal on a septic system?
A trash can for scraps or a backyard compost bin does not add any solid load to the tank at all, and composting has the added benefit of keeping grease and coffee grounds out of the system entirely.
